赋值运算符 
我们已经知道您可以使用输入运算符设置任何变量的值。 输入语句用于用户在程序执行期间指定值的情况。 
但是,我们经常需要通过使用特定公式计算变量来为其设置新值。在这种情况下,-  赋值运算符 将帮助我们。我们已经在最近的问题中使用过它了。现在让我们更详细地谈谈它。
 
 赋值运算符的一般形式如下:
 
<变量名> = <表达式>;
 
赋值运算符是这样工作的: 
1. 首先对赋值符号右边的表达式求值。 
2. 表达式的结果值存储(比如“ 赋值”)赋值符号左侧的变量中。在这种情况下,变量的旧值被擦除。
 
例如,如果我们需要将  c 变量的值设置为  b 变量值的两倍,那么我们需要这样写:
 
c = 2 * b;
不要忘记,在编程中您不能在表达式中省略乘号。否则,计算机将无法理解你要乘什么。 
例如,你不能只写c = 2b,那是错误的! 
            
            
                  
            
             
                    
            
                 
      
                  
           | 
	
		
 
     
              
              
                  
                       
            
                
          
            赋值运算符右边的表达式可以让你计算值使用各种公式。< br />
 
一个表达式可以包含什么 
X整数和实数(在实数中,整数和小数部分用点分隔,而不是逗号,这是数学中的习惯); 
•算术符号:  
    + 加法; 
<代码>    - 减法; 
<代码>    * 乘法; 
<代码>    / 划分; 
<代码>    % 取模。
 
•标准函数调用: 
 Math.Abs(x)  - 实数模块 x; 
 Math.Sqrt(x)  - 实数的平方根 x; 
 Math.Pow(x,y)  - 计算 x 的 y 次方。 
 
•括号更改操作顺序。 
 
            
            
                  
            
             
                    
            
                 
      
                  
           | 
	
		
 
     
              
              
                  
                       
            
                
          
            任何编程语言都包含许多可用于算术表达式的内置函数。 
要使用额外的功能,您通常需要包含额外的库。 
 
例如,最常用的标准数学函数及其在 C# 中的表示法。
 Math.Abs(x) -  真实 模块 x; 
 Math.Sqrt(x) -  实数的平方根 x; 
 Math.Pow(x,y) - < /code>计算 x 的 y 次方。 
 
请记住,函数参数始终 写在括号中。
  
            
            
                  
            
             
                    
            
                 
      
                  
           | 
	
		
 
     
              
              
                  
                       
            
                
          
            用编程语言编写算术表达式的规则 
 
假设我们需要按照以下  方式评估以数学形式编写的表达式:
在编写为我们计算结果的程序之前,我们制定规则 编程语言中代数表达式的记录: 
 1.表达式包含数字、其他变量名、运算符、括号、函数名。< br />
2.算术运算及其符号(+, -, *, /, % em>). 
3.整数和小数部分之间用点号分隔。 
4、 表达式每行写一个 (表达式的线性表示法),字符依次排列,所有运算符都放下;使用括号。 
 
因此,按照算术表达式的书写规则,我们必须将这个(数学记数法)分数转化为线性记数法,即把分数写在一行中。 
分子和分母包含复杂的(即包含两个或多个因子)表达式,那么在写成线性形式时,需要 span style="font -family:Arial,Helvetica,sans-serif">圆括号 表达式中的分子和分母。 
因此,这种表达式的线性表示法如下所示: 
 
<代码>(2*17.56*17.56)/(7*2.47*0.43)代码> 
 
让我们编写一个程序来计算这个表达式: 为此,让我们定义输入和输出数据。 
 
输入数据: 所有的值都是已知的,所以不需要从键盘输入任何东西,因此不会有输入数据。 
 
输出数据:程序应显示给定算术表达式的结果(您可以将其输入任何变量,或立即在屏幕上显示该值)。 
 
我们将立即在屏幕上显示表达式的结果,而不将其保存在任何变量中。   
结果将是一个实数。 
<前>
 使用系统;
类程序{
   静态无效主要(){
        Console.WriteLine((2 * 17.56 * 17.56) / (7 * 2.47 * 0.43));
    }
}
在您的计算机上运行该程序并确保其输出 82.949843。 em> 
  
            
            
                  
            
             
                    
            
                 
      
                  
           |